Amounts that are "deemed 125 compensation" are not included in the definition of compensation. What is "deemed" referring to?

Speaking / writing about 125 compensation, if a sponsor elects "W-2 Wages" to define compensation, are Section 125 contribution amounts included or excluded for determining employee deferral and employer matching allocations?
QDROphile
Look at Rev. Rul. 2002-27. I think there is some other IRS guidnace that is related.
stevena
when a doc says "W-2 wages", (in all our adoption agreements that we work with at least), right below that compensation question is another question which gives guidance about what to add or not add to those W-2 wages.
